What Factors Affect Battery Life and Efficiency?
Several factors can significantly influence battery life and efficiency.
- Battery Chemistry: The type of chemistry used in the battery, such as lithium-ion or lithium-polymer, plays a crucial role in its longevity and performance. Lithium-ion batteries are commonly used in smartphones due to their high energy density and ability to withstand numerous charge cycles without significant degradation.
- Temperature: Extreme temperatures can adversely affect battery performance, with high heat leading to faster degradation and cold temperatures causing reduced capacity. Maintaining an optimal operating temperature can help in prolonging battery life and ensuring consistent efficiency.
- Charge Cycles: A charge cycle is defined as the process of charging a battery from 0% to 100%, and each cycle contributes to the wear and tear of the battery. Frequent full discharges and recharges can shorten battery lifespan, so partial charges are often recommended to extend longevity.
- Usage Patterns: How often and in what manner the device is used can greatly impact battery efficiency. Intensive tasks such as gaming, streaming, or using GPS can drain the battery faster compared to lighter tasks like texting or browsing, thereby affecting overall battery life.
- Software Optimization: The operating system and applications running on the device can influence battery performance through their efficiency in managing resources. Regular software updates often include optimizations that can enhance battery life by reducing background activity and improving app management.
- Battery Age: Over time, batteries naturally lose capacity due to chemical aging, which can result in diminished performance. As a battery ages, its ability to hold a charge decreases, leading to shorter usage times and potentially affecting the device’s overall functionality.
- Charging Habits: How and when a battery is charged can also impact its longevity. Using fast chargers, charging overnight, or leaving the battery plugged in after it reaches full charge can contribute to overheating and wear over time.

How Can You Safely Install an Aftermarket iPhone Battery?
To safely install an aftermarket iPhone battery, follow these essential steps:
- Choose a Quality Aftermarket Battery: Select a reputable brand that is known for producing reliable and safe batteries.
- Gather Necessary Tools: Ensure you have the right tools, such as a pentalobe screwdriver, plastic opening tools, and a suction cup.
- Power Off Your Device: Always turn off your iPhone completely before starting the installation process to avoid any electrical issues.
- Open the iPhone Carefully: Use the appropriate tools to gently pry open the device, taking care not to damage any internal components.
- Disconnect the Battery: Locate and carefully disconnect the battery connector from the logic board to ensure no power is flowing.
- Replace the Battery: Remove the old battery and install the new aftermarket battery, ensuring that it is securely connected.
- Reassemble the iPhone: Once the new battery is in place, carefully reassemble your iPhone, ensuring all screws are replaced and components are correctly positioned.
- Test the New Battery: After reassembly, power on your device to check that the new battery is functioning correctly and holds a charge.
Choosing a Quality Aftermarket Battery: It’s crucial to select an aftermarket battery from a well-reviewed manufacturer, as lower-quality batteries can lead to overheating, reduced performance, or even damage to the device. Look for batteries that come with good warranties and positive customer feedback to ensure reliability.
Gather Necessary Tools: Having the right tools on hand makes the installation process smoother and reduces the risk of damaging your iPhone. A pentalobe screwdriver is essential for opening the case, while plastic opening tools help to safely pry apart the device without scratching or breaking any parts.
Power Off Your Device: Turning off your iPhone is a critical safety step that prevents any electrical shorts or accidental damage to the internal components during the battery replacement process. Always ensure the device is completely powered down before proceeding.
Open the iPhone Carefully: When opening your iPhone, take your time and be gentle. Using a suction cup can help lift the screen without applying too much pressure, and using plastic tools minimizes the risk of scratching or cracking the screen.
Disconnect the Battery: Locate the battery connector and gently disconnect it from the logic board. This step is vital to ensure that there is no power running through the device while you are working on it, which could cause harm to the components or lead to personal injury.
Replace the Battery: After removing the old battery, install the new aftermarket battery by carefully connecting it to the logic board. Make sure it fits snugly and securely to avoid any issues with power delivery or battery performance.
Reassemble the iPhone: Once the new battery is installed, put the iPhone back together, making sure that all parts are aligned correctly and all screws are tightened. This ensures that the device is sealed properly and minimizes the risk of dust or moisture entering.
Test the New Battery: After you have reassembled the iPhone, power it on and check if the new battery is functioning properly. Monitor the charging process and battery performance to confirm that it meets your expectations.
